charset=UTF-8; format=flowed Content-Transfer-Encoding: 7bit X-MBO-RS-ID: 95a871c755375494b81 X-MBO-RS-META: gsb99t9ej18ugjwbxn3iuk755yh9d7m3 X-CRM114-Version: 20100106-BlameMichelson ( TRE 0.9.0 (BSD) ) MR-646709E3 X-CRM114-CacheID: sfid-20260908_092730_455682_3ED7E65C X-CRM114-Status: GOOD ( 15.82 ) X-BeenThere: linux-arm-kernel@lists.infradead.org X-Mailman-Version: 2.1.34 Precedence: list List-Id: List-Unsubscribe: , List-Archive: List-Post: List-Help: List-Subscribe: , Sender: "linux-arm-kernel" Errors-To: linux-arm-kernel-bounces+linux-arm-kernel=archiver.kernel.org@lists.infradead.org On 9/8/26 10:46 AM, Geert Uytterhoeven wrote: Hello Geert, > As I am not PCIe DT expert, I am comparing this to the corresponding > patch for R-Car V4H, which I have already queued as commit > 7fe73a3a3f2c3718 ("arm64: dts: renesas: r8a779g0: Add GICv3 ITS and > update PCIe nodes") in renesas-devel, but which probably needs some > updates. I sent a fix for that one: [PATCH] arm64: dts: renesas: r8a779g0: Add MSI cells to GICv3 ITS >> --- a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/renesas/r8a779h0.dtsi >> +++ b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/renesas/r8a779h0.dtsi >> @@ -691,6 +691,8 @@ pciec0: pcie@e65d0000 { >> resets = <&cpg 624>, <&cpg 1121>; >> reset-names = "pwr", "core"; >> max-link-speed = <4>; >> + msi-parent = <&its 0>; > > This has an extra cell "0", which is probably correct, given > "#msi-cells = <1>" below. > >> + msi-map = <0x0 &its 0x0 0x10000>; > > This is not present on R-Car V4H (which is probably wrong). > > Interestingly, Documentation/devicetree/bindings/pci/pci-ep.yaml > documents msi-map for endpoint node, so should it be added to the > pcie-ep node, too? I do not think we should be adding it until we can test ITS with EP ? This patch adds the ITS only to the RC side, where I can test it.
